The Stage Manager feature is surely one of the most loved and awaited feature introduced with macOS 13 Ventura.
If you are using the Stage Manager feature and want to see the desktop screen as you toggle between applications, well you can simply click anywhere out the application which is active, and all the windows will go back to the Stage Manager left side and your desktop will be visible.
This is really an abt way to see and choose what there on your Mac Desktop easier and efficient.
